The desert beauty contest judged by Wodaabe women

HERE’S THE INTERESTING PART

Flipped gender dynamics make this nomadic gathering the ultimate spectacle of human vanity in the best way possible. Deep in the Nigerien desert, young Wodaabe men paint their faces, roll their eyes, and perform grueling endurance dances for hours just to impress the female judges. It serves as an exhausting, kaleidoscopic matrimonial swipe-right happening thousands of miles away from reliable cell reception.
